Deirdre Prischmann-Voldseth is a Professor in the Department of Entomology at North Dakota State University's College of Agriculture, Food Systems, and Natural Resources. She maintains her office in 265 Hultz Hall and can be reached at (701)-231-9805 or deirdre.prischmann@ndsu.edu.
Her educational background includes:
- Ph.D. in Entomology from Washington State University (2005)
- M.S. in Entomology from Oregon State University (2001)
- B.A. in Biology from Alfred University (1997)
Dr. Prischmann-Voldseth's research spans three primary areas with significant practical applications. Her work in Integrated Pest Management focuses on combining biological control and host plant resistance strategies to develop sustainable pest control solutions. In Rhizosphere-Insect-Plant Interactions, she investigates how soil properties and soil biota impact herbivorous arthropods and their natural enemies, with particular attention to microbial inoculants' effects on crop plants under insect attack. Her Cultural Entomology research explores the historical and artistic representation of insects, particularly in Japanese woodblock prints and industrial-era art.

Dr. Prischmann-Voldseth has received numerous prestigious awards including:
- NACTA Educator Award (2021)
- NDSU CAFSNR Excellence in Teaching Award (2020)
- International IPM Award of Excellence (2018)
- Multiple NACTA Teaching Awards
- Entomological Society of America awards
As an educator, she teaches General Entomology (ENT 350), Overview of Entomology (ENT 696), and Principles of Insect Pest Management (ENT 431/631). Beyond academia, she is an accomplished children's book author (both fiction and non-fiction) who secured representation with the Jean V. Naggar Literary Agency in May 2022.
